Which is better, quartz or granite?

Both quartz and granite are excellent choices for Nebraska kitchens. Granite offers unique, natural patterns and is very durable. Quartz is engineered for consistency, is non-porous, and highly resistant to stains and scratches. The best choice depends on your personal style and how you use your kitchen.

What is the downside of granite countertops?

Granite countertops are natural stone and are porous, meaning they require sealing to prevent stains from absorbing. They can also be susceptible to chipping if heavy objects are dropped on their edges. Proper care and regular sealing are important for maintaining their appearance in your Omaha kitchen.

What are butcher block countertops?

Butcher block countertops are made from solid wood strips glued together, offering a warm, natural surface. They are great for food prep but require maintenance. In Nebraska's climate, proper sealing is crucial to protect them from moisture and temperature changes. We can help you choose the right wood and finish for durability.
